EA's Financial Result Reveals Layoffs, Closures and Delays

by Rainier on Nov. 1, 2007 @ 3:46 p.m. PDT | Filed under News

EA released its latest financial results, revealing a loss of $195M, compared to last year's profit of $22M. As a result, EA's board approved a reorganization in order to save $25-30M, which unfortunately means layoffs and branch closures, such as its UK office in Chertsey. At the request of EA Mythic's Mark Jacobs, Warhammer Online is facing yet another delay from its original Q1 2008 date. It's been pushed to Q2 2008 (not before April), but EA execs are still excited about the coming holidays and even raised their expectations with heavy hitters such as Crysis, Hellgate: London and RockBand.

'Overlord' (X360) Downloadable Content Revealed - Screens & Trailer

by Rainier on Nov. 1, 2007 @ 6:37 a.m. PDT | Filed under News

Overlord is an action adventure set in a warped fantasy world where players can be evil (or really evil). Later this month Codemasters will release 3 pieces of premium content for the X360, starting with Raising Hell, a singleplayer expansion that introduces hell to the game's 5 kingdoms, followed by The Challenge Pack (7 new maps & 2 game modes), while a free download will finally add split-screen, as well as a new multiplayer map. All of this will be available on PC as part of a Special Edition.

'Assassin's Creed' (ALL) Novel Trilogy Canceled

by Rainier on Nov. 1, 2007 @ 5:31 a.m. PDT | Filed under News

Earlier this year, Pocket Books acquired the rights to publish the novelization of Ubisoft's upcoming action/adventure game Assassin's Creed, but it turns out the deal has been abandoned. Author of the two first novels, Steven Barnes, revealed Ubisoft wanted to remove religious references and have the books vetted by an expert, which "disenchanted" Pocket Books, and the deal died.
